Abstract

See full text

A programmable processing engine processes transient data within an intermediate network station of a computer network. The engine comprises an array of processing elements symmetrically arrayed as rows and columns, and embedded between input and output buffer units with a plurality of interfaces from the array to an external memory. The external memory stores non-transient data organized within data structures, such as forwarding and routing tables, for use in processing the transient data. Each processing element contains an instruction memory that allows programming of the array to process the transient data as processing element stages of baseline or extended pipelines operating in parallel.
